WHAT WE DID

Swingers needed to drive bookings and group enquiries while elevating its brand in an increasingly competitive on trade market. We built a performance-led ecosystem that transformed venues, content, and community into a unified growth engine.

By balancing demand generation with premium brand building, we positioned Swingers as more than a venue - turning it into a culturally relevant social destination that drives both bookings and long-term audience growth.

THE CHALLENGE

The objective was to drive bookings and group enquiries while delivering against strict performance KPIs, all within a crowded social activity landscape. This required not only efficient conversion, but also elevating brand perception, accelerating audience growth, and creating a clear point of difference across platforms.

THE APPROACH

We built a full-funnel growth system combining always-on performance with high-impact cultural moments. Premium, London-centric influencers were invited into curated VIP experiences designed for shareability, turning real visits into high-performing content. 

This was amplified through paid social and CRM to drive direct bookings, while quarterly “Big Bang” events with partners and talent created spikes in cultural relevance and reach. Alongside this, a consistent stream of premium content and competition-led social activity fuelled follower growth, engagement, and ongoing demand - creating a continuous loop between brand, community, and performance.

THE OUTCOME

The campaign delivered strong commercial performance, generating £1.2M in revenue with a 7x ROAS, while maintaining highly efficient CPC and CPA benchmarks. Influencer activation and content drove scale, reaching 15M users and adding 10K new followers across platforms.

Crucially, the strategy didn’t just convert—it elevated the brand. By combining cultural moments with performance media, Swingers strengthened its market position and built a repeatable model for sustained growth.
